Downtown Davis is the walkable urban core surrounding UC Davis, characterized by a mix of 1920s through 1960s single-family homes, converted duplexes, and small apartment buildings along tree-lined streets. The housing stock reflects Davis' evolution from a small agricultural college town to a university city — compact bungalows with original kitchens sit alongside mid-century homes that have been converted to student rentals, each presenting distinct appliance service requirements shaped by building age and usage intensity.
Student rental properties dominate the Downtown Davis appliance landscape. Landlord-installed appliances endure significantly heavier use than owner-occupied equivalents — washing machines running multiple daily loads, refrigerators opened dozens of times by rotating roommates, and dishwashers cycling continuously during the academic year. This intensive usage accelerates component wear, and many Downtown Davis rentals cycle through appliance replacements on compressed timelines. Our technicians serve both landlords seeking cost-effective repairs to extend rental appliance life and homeowners maintaining their personal residences with more attentive care.
Davis' recent transition from deep-well groundwater to Sacramento River surface water has changed the mineral profile affecting Downtown appliances. Historically, Davis well water was among the hardest in the Sacramento region, leaving heavy calcium deposits in dishwashers, ice makers, and washing machine components. The surface water blend is softer, but appliances that accumulated years of well-water scale retain that mineral burden in their internal passages. Descaling service on long-installed Downtown Davis appliances often removes surprisingly heavy deposits that predate the water source change.

Downtown Davis homes from the 1920s-1960s have compact bungalow kitchens with original infrastructure. Galvanized plumbing restricts water flow to dishwashers, aging electrical panels limit safe loads, and converted duplexes often have non-standard appliance installations that require creative service approaches.
